Cryogenic Tank Containers & Storage Tanks “Rental and Installation”

20ft & 40ft T75 Tank Containers, Bulk Storage Tanks in a range of sizes up to 150,000 litres, These tanks are approved to Australia standards and are used for the Transport and Storage of liquid Oxygen, Argon, Nitrogen, LNG and Carbon Dioxide.

How the C-Lift Works

The portable and economic nature of the C-Lift, is derived from BISON’s patent pending “lift & lock” mechanism. Relatively short hydraulic cylinders with a 30cm (12″) stroke lift the container to 165cm (65″) in a series of steps, providing clearance for a trailer to move in or out from under the container.
